An evening between romantic grandeur and modern sound language
On Wednesday, September 9, 2026, the community hall of the Neustädter Marienkirche in Bielefeld will open its doors for a piano evening featuring works by Franz Liszt and György Kurtág. Julian Gast, a young pianist from Lübeck/Salzburg, will be at the piano, presenting a program that juxtaposes large sound arcs and fine miniatures. Admission is free; donations for church music at the Protestant city cantorship are requested. A venue with historical aura
The Neustädter Marienkirche is one of Bielefeld's prominent landmarks and is considered the oldest and largest preserved church in the city. With its twin tower profile, late Romanesque-early Gothic character, and the famous Marian altar from 1400, it embodies the quiet dignity that adds special tension to a piano evening.
